Slumber, Yoga, and Pinot Noir: The Shield Against Alzheimer’s

Explore the potential benefits of slumber, yoga, and Pinot Noir in protecting against Alzheimer’s disease. Discover how quality sleep, regular yoga practice, and moderate wine consumption may contribute to brain health

Alzheimer’s disease, a progressive and irreversible brain disorder, continues to affect millions of people worldwide.

With no known cure, the focus has shifted towards adopting preventive measures to reduce the risk of developing this debilitating condition. Slumber, yoga, and Pinot Noir – these seemingly disparate elements – have emerged as potential shields against Alzheimer’s.

This article explores the latest research and insights on how quality sleep, regular yoga practice, and moderate consumption of Pinot Noir may contribute to brain health and protect against Alzheimer’s disease.

Slumber: The Restorative Power of Sleep

A good night’s sleep is not just rejuvenating for the body but also crucial for the brain’s health and overall well-being. During sleep, the brain consolidates memories, clears out toxins, and repairs cellular damage.

Lack of adequate sleep has been linked to an increased risk of cognitive decline and the development of Alzheimer’s disease. Research suggests that chronic sleep deprivation may accelerate the accumulation of beta-amyloid plaques in the brain, a hallmark of Alzheimer’s.

The Sleep-Alzheimer’s Connection

Several studies have highlighted the intricate relationship between sleep disturbances and Alzheimer’s disease.

One study conducted by researchers at Harvard Medical School found that poor sleep quality was associated with higher levels of beta-amyloid deposition in the brain. Another study published in the journal Science revealed that disrupted sleep may trigger an immune response in the brain, leading to the formation of neurotoxic proteins associated with Alzheimer’s.

The Role of Deep Sleep

Deep sleep, also known as slow-wave sleep, plays a vital role in memory consolidation and the elimination of beta-amyloid plaques. However, as individuals age, the amount of deep sleep they experience tends to decline.

This decline in deep sleep has been linked to an increased risk of cognitive impairment and Alzheimer’s disease. Therefore, adopting strategies to enhance deep sleep may have a protective effect against Alzheimer’s.

Creating the Ideal Sleep Environment

Several lifestyle adjustments can optimize the quality and duration of sleep.

Establishing a consistent sleep routine, limiting exposure to blue light-emitting devices before bed, practicing relaxation techniques, and creating a comfortable sleep environment are all effective measures. The sleep environment should be cool, dark, and quiet, promoting uninterrupted and restorative sleep.

The Benefits of Yoga

Yoga, an ancient practice that combines physical postures, breathing exercises, and meditation, offers numerous benefits for both physical and mental well-being.

Recent studies have shown promising connections between regular yoga practice and improved brain health. The mind-body connection cultivated through yoga may prove invaluable in lowering the risk of Alzheimer’s disease.

Mindfulness and Cognitive Function

Yoga emphasizes mindfulness, which involves directing attention to the present moment without judgment. This technique has been shown to enhance cognitive function and protect against age-related cognitive decline.

By focusing on breath control and body awareness, yoga practitioners may experience improved attention, memory, and overall cognitive performance.

Stress Reduction and Neuroplasticity

Chronic stress has a detrimental impact on brain health and has been linked to an increased risk of Alzheimer’s disease.

Yoga, with its emphasis on controlled breathing and conscious movement, activates the parasympathetic nervous system, leading to a relaxation response. Regular yoga practice reduces stress hormones, such as cortisol, and promotes neuroplasticity – the brain’s ability to reorganize and form new connections, potentially acting as a protective mechanism against Alzheimer’s.

The Pinot Noir Paradigm

While excessive alcohol consumption is associated with adverse health effects, moderate wine consumption has garnered attention for its potential neuroprotective benefits.

Among the various wine options, Pinot Noir, a red wine made from a specific grape variety, stands out as a potentially beneficial choice for brain health.

The Antioxidant Resveratrol

Pinot Noir is rich in resveratrol, a potent antioxidant found in grape skins. Resveratrol has demonstrated various neuroprotective effects in preclinical studies, including anti-inflammatory and antioxidant properties.

It may also protect against beta-amyloid aggregation, a key process in Alzheimer’s disease pathogenesis.

Cardiovascular Health and Brain Health

Research suggests that cardiovascular health plays a significant role in brain health. The moderate consumption of red wine, including Pinot Noir, has been associated with a reduced risk of cardiovascular diseases.

By promoting healthy blood flow and protecting blood vessels from damage, red wine may indirectly contribute to brain health and help lower the risk of cognitive decline and Alzheimer’s disease.

Moderation is Key

It is essential to emphasize that the potential benefits of Pinot Noir and red wine consumption for brain health are contingent upon moderation. Excessive alcohol intake can lead to detrimental health effects, including an increased risk of dementia.

Moderate wine consumption is defined as one glass per day for women and up to two glasses per day for men, following the guidelines provided by health organizations.
